PHP开发用的软件
PHP是一种流行的开源脚本语言,特别适用于Web开发,并且能够很好地嵌入HTML中。对于希望使用PHP进行网站或应用程序开发的人来说,选择合适的开发工具至关重要。这篇文章将介绍一些常用的PHP开发软件及其功能特点,帮助你更好地开始你的PHP开发之旅。
一、了解PHP开发环境
在开始介绍具体的软件之前,理解什么是PHP开发环境是非常重要的。一个完整的PHP开发环境通常包括PHP解释器、Web服务器(如Apache)、数据库系统(如MySQL)以及用于编写和调试代码的编辑器或集成开发环境(IDE)。这样的组合允许开发者在一个本地环境中测试他们的代码,而无需直接访问互联网。
步骤:
- 确定操作系统:不同的操作系统可能需要不同版本的安装包。
- 选择适合自己的Web服务器软件。
- 安装并配置好所选的数据库管理系统。
- 下载最新版的PHP并根据官方指南完成安装。
- 测试整个设置是否工作正常,可以通过创建简单的“Hello, World!”页面来验证。
二、XAMPP
XAMPP是一个非常流行的免费跨平台Web服务堆栈,它包含了Apache Web Server、MySQL Database、PHP 和 Perl 脚本语言等组件,非常适合初学者快速搭建起一个基本的Web开发环境。
步骤:
- 访问官方网站下载对应操作系统的XAMPP安装包。
- 按照向导提示完成安装过程,期间可以选择自定义安装路径及所需组件。
- 启动控制面板启动Apache与MySQL服务。
- 在浏览器中输入
http://localhost/
检查安装是否成功。 - 将项目文件放置于XAMPP的htdocs目录下即可通过本地服务器访问。
三、WAMP
WAMP是专为Windows用户设计的一个简单易用的Web开发平台,其名称来源于包含的主要技术:Windows操作系统、Apache HTTP服务器、MySQL关系型数据库管理系统以及PHP编程语言。
步骤:
- 从官网获取最新的WAMP安装程序。
- 执行安装文件,按照屏幕上的指示逐步完成安装。
- 开启WAMP服务,这通常意味着同时启动了Apache和MySQL服务。
- 通过访问
http://localhost/
确保一切设置正确无误。 - 把你的PHP项目放到www文件夹内以供浏览。
四、MAMP
MAMP是一个针对Mac OS X用户的完整Web开发套件,提供了一种简便的方法来安装和运行所有必要的Web开发组件。除了支持macOS外,还有专门针对Windows用户的版本称为MAMP for Windows。
步骤:
- 前往MAMP官方网站下载适用于您计算机的操作系统版本。
- 双击下载好的.dmg文件打开安装界面,拖拽图标至Applications文件夹完成安装。
- 打开MAMP应用,点击Start Servers按钮启动服务器。
- 使用默认地址
http://localhost:8888/MAMP/
访问初始页面。 - 创建新的主机名或者直接修改htdocs文件夹下的内容来部署您的项目。
五、Laragon
Laragon是一款轻量级但功能强大的本地Web开发环境,专门为Windows用户打造。它不仅集成了Nginx/Apache、PHP、MySQL等核心组件,还提供了Git、Composer等多种常用工具的支持。
步骤:
- 到Laragon官网上找到最新的稳定版下载链接。
- 解压下载的.zip文件到任意位置,推荐不要放在C盘根目录下。
- 运行laragon.exe启动管理器,随后依次开启所需的各项服务。
- 通过命令行界面或者图形界面轻松添加/删除站点。
- 对于高级需求,还可以利用内置的终端执行更多复杂操作。
六、Sublime Text 或 Visual Studio Code
虽然上述提到的都是用来构建PHP运行环境的软件,但对于实际编写代码来说,一个好的文本编辑器或IDE同样必不可少。这里推荐两款广受好评的选择——Sublime Text和Visual Studio Code (VSCode)。它们都具有丰富的插件生态系统,能够极大地提高编码效率。
步骤(以VSCode为例):
- 从Microsoft官网下载Visual Studio Code安装程序。
- 根据指引完成安装流程。
- 打开VSCode后,前往扩展市场搜索PHP相关的插件,比如"PHP Intelephense"或"PHP Debug"等。
- 安装完毕后重启VSCode使更改生效。
- 创建一个新的PHP文件(.php),尝试编写几行代码看看自动补全等功能是否正常工作。
以上就是关于PHP开发过程中可能会用到的一些基础软件介绍。每款工具有着各自的特点与适用场景,请根据个人喜好和技术背景选择最适合自己的那一款。希望这篇教程能为你开启PHP学习之路带来帮助!